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Apache Kafka
- Operationally heavy to self-host: brokers, storage, rebalancing and upgrades are a standing job, which is why managed Kafka is a large market
- Overkill for straightforward job queues, where a simpler broker is easier to run and reason about
- Ordering guarantees hold per partition, not per topic, and getting partitioning wrong is a common and expensive design mistake
- The ecosystem is fragmented across the Apache project and vendor distributions, so documentation and tooling advice often assume a particular distribution
Asana
- The free Personal tier is capped at 2 users, so it does not cover a small team
- Timeline and Gantt views, reporting dashboards and time tracking all require Starter at $10.99 per user per month
- Portfolios, goals, workload management and approvals need Advanced at $24.99 per user per month
- Salesforce, Tableau and Power BI integrations are Advanced or above
- Monthly billing costs more, at $13.49 and $30.49 against the annual rates

Apache Kafka: Is Apache Kafka free?
Yes. Kafka is open source under the Apache License v2 with no licence fee. Costs come from the infrastructure you run it on, or from a managed service such as Confluent Cloud.

SourceApache Kafka: How is Kafka different from a message queue?
A queue usually removes a message once it is consumed. Kafka keeps an ordered, durable log, so consumers track their own position and history can be replayed — which is what makes rebuilding state after a bug possible.

SourceApache Kafka: Do I need to run Kafka myself?
No. Self-hosting is the operationally expensive option; managed services such as Confluent Cloud run the brokers for you and bill on throughput and storage instead.
